Job Description & How to Apply Below
* Interpret and analyze high-level requirements to ensure alignment with intended vehicle-level behavior.

* Develop and implement control algorithms for electric motor applications within powertrain systems using MATLAB-Simulink and C/C++

* Process data received via communication network and validate them using standardized methods

* Support diagnostic development and OBD compliance activities.

* Collaborate with cross-functional teams in a fast-paced environment to deliver high-quality solutions.

* Ensure compliance with ISO 26262 functional safety standards.

* Perform pre-verification of the implementation through Model In The Loop (MIL) testing and pre-verification of the generated code, through Software in the Loop (SIL) testing

* Develop proto software builds as required and validate on Hardware In the Loop ( HIL) , Dynamometer or vehicle using ETAS INCA tools;

* Own DVP&R's for assigned SWCs and perform updates when SW content is updated.

* Analyze and provide timely response/solutions to the tracked issues;

* Develop & maintain controls` design documents for assigned software components.

* Participate and contribute in daily scrum meetings, regularly track SW development using Agile methodology , actively participate in Big room planning activities and sprint planning sessions

Basic Qualifications:

* Bachelor's degree in Electrical, Mechanical, Computer Engineering or related degree field

* Minimum of 5-year experience in the following:

* Engine or electric Motor Controls development in MATLAB/Simulink auto-coding environment

* AUTOSAR software development experience using DSPACE System Desk and RTE

* Demonstrated technical problem solving

* Demonstrated working level experience in decomposing intended function into controls design documents

* Strong overall knowledge of vehicle and powertrain functions

* Experience with modeling, simulation, development, testing, calibration and/or validation

* Outstanding interpersonal and problem-solving skills

Preferred Qualifications:

* Advanced degree in with emphasis in core Motor controls, power electronics, and electrical machines.

* Embedded C++ programming

* Analysis of CAN logs, including message counter and CRC calculation and verification

* Controls design experience to meet ISO 26262 functional safety compliance.

* Design For Six Sigma green belt, Reactive Problem-Solving green belt

* Proven experience in setting up use cases to analyze large amount of data for prognostics or tuning purposes using AI techniques
